Definition of SDN
SDN is a network paradigm that separates the network control plane from the data plane, allowing for centralized and programmatic control over network behavior. This separation enables network administrators to manage network traffic and make changes more dynamically and efficiently than in traditional networks.
Working Principle of SDN
SDN operates by decoupling the control plane from the data plane, with the control plane managed by a central controller software. This allows for a more programmable, flexible, and controllable network environment.
.Future Trends in SDN
The future of SDN is expected to involve more open and flexible data planes, with OpenFlow continuing to evolve as a mainstream southbound interface protocol in SDN. The technology is also expected to further integrate with other emerging technologies like cloud computing, big data, and IoT, showcasing SDN's significant role in modern network architectures.
